Abstract
The design community and stakeholders started to accept the concept of “Green Buildings. ” The green buildings incorporate better practical solutions, with respect to the present market or design requirements, that reduce the environmental load. Although the development of green buildings has a considerable success in the today’s market, this concept is only the first step towards the sustainable buildings. Over the past three decades, researchers discussed other approaches for assessing the sustainability of a given development, including buildings. The paper presents a short summary of indices of sustainability with applications to buildings, with emphasis on those based on the second law of thermodynamics. The paper also presents examples from some case studies from the author’s research projects, related to the building envelope and HVAC systems.
